A Prophecy from the Past
In The Harbinger by Jonathan Cahn, we are introduced to Nouriel Kaplan, a journalist who receives a mysterious, ancient seal from an old man. In his quest to discover the source of this symbol, Nouriel unearths an eerie narrative set 2,500 years ago. He learns of an ancient prophecy from the biblical prophet Isaiah, warning about a future disaster.
As Nouriel delves deeper, he believes the prophecy is coming into fruition in modern-day America, drawing eerily specific parallels to the 9/11 attacks and the financial crisis of 2008. He translates the prophetic signs, or "harbingers", and sees their manifestation in real-world events — a contemporary reality signaling the nation's decline.
An Unheeded Warning
Nouriel’s journey continues as he discovers each subsequent harbinger, nine in total which originally forewarned Israel of its destruction as a result of turning away from God. Aligning with the story of Israel, America is also choosing a similar path of ignorance, refusing to acknowledge the warning signs of imminent disaster. Nouriel feels a deep responsibility to spread this message and decorate the imminent problems.
This ancient prophecy and its implications soon consume Nouriel completely, leading him on frantic journeys around the Valley of Shinar, Ground Zero, and various American governmental locations. He sees insurmountable evidence in events and objects, such as the sycamore tree at Ground Zero, the construction of the Freedom Tower, and even the words of American leaders.
Spiritual Connection
Despite its alarming revelations, The Harbinger primarily urges a return to spirituality, reminding us that our actions and moral choices have consequences, and that turning a blind eye to clear signs and warnings can lead to our downfall.
While Nouriel realizes that he cannot prevent the dire events that are slated to happen, he understands that the core message of the prophecy is one of hope, about acknowledging missteps, learning from them, and redeeming oneself through faith and spirituality. The book thus carries a deeply religious undertone – a call-to-action for humanity to return to The Almighty.
Realization and Redemption
As the narrative progresses, it becomes evident that the ominous old man is more than he appears and is deeply connected to Nouriel's discovery. Nouriel is consequently pushed to evaluate his worldview, and the skepticism he once had morphs into acceptance, then faith. This spiritual journey marks the transformation of Nouriel, both as an individual and as a means of symbolizing a broader collective awakening.
In the conclusion of The Harbinger, we, along with Nouriel, are left with a resonating message about the importance of faith, repentance, and ultimately, redemption. The book pushes us to not only recognize the signs that history provides but also remember that there is always a path to redemption, should we choose to take it.
